DESCRIPTION:
LOT 1 – EXTENDING TO 160.69 ACRES / 65.03 HA
Located to the southeast of the village of Chilham, the main block of land generally slopes down towards the north. The additional parcel on Mountain Street, is flat and has in recent years been managed under Option AB16 - Autumn sown bumblebird mix under a Countryside Stewardship agreement.
LOT 2 – EXTENDING TO 22.73 ACRES / 9.20 HA
Located close to the village of Chilham, these parcels slope very gradually to the north.
SOILS AND CURRENT MANAGEMENT: The land is classified as Grade III on the DEFRA Agricultural Land Classification. Soilscape notes the soil for the majority of the land as freely draining lime-rich loamy soils, with part of the soil described as shallow lime-rich soils. The parcel on Mountain Street is described as loamy clayey floodplain soils with naturally higher groundwater.
Unless otherwise stated, the land has been managed in an arable rotation and is currently cropped with winter wheat.
